Absolute Efficiency
Filtration Performance
Also: single-pass efficiency · absolute filtration efficiency
Abbrev: AE
Canonical Definition
Filter efficiency expressed as the percentage of particles of a specified size removed in a single pass through the filter element, derived from the Beta ratio: Absolute Efficiency = (1 − 1/β_x(c)) × 100%. A β₁₀(c) of 200 corresponds to 99.5% absolute efficiency at 10 µm. Absolute efficiency ratings are measured under standardised multi-pass test conditions per ISO 16889.
Engineering Context
Absolute efficiency is the correct metric when specifying filters for critical systems including servo valves, proportional valves, and precision hydraulic actuators. Unlike nominal efficiency, absolute efficiency values are reproducible across test laboratories because they derive from a defined multi-pass test protocol.
